aboutsummaryrefslogtreecommitdiffstats
path: root/conf/machine
AgeCommit message (Collapse)AuthorFilesLines
2012-09-30imx-base.inc: Fix mx5 GPU library API supportOtavio Salvador1-1/+3
The mx5 GPU libraries provide OpenGL ES1, OpenEGL and OpenGL ES2 only so we need to ajust the PREFERRED_PROVIDER. Change-Id: I569fabc91349c3d3a8804ff72e67e9bcc88b1267 Signed-off-by: Otavio Salvador <otavio@ossystems.com.br>
2012-09-25imx31pdk: Override U-Boot targetAmjad Afzaal1-0/+2
The imx-base.inc default to use u-boot.imx as U-Boot target and imx as U-Boot suffix but the Soc needs to use u-boot-nand.bin as U-Boot target and bin as U-Boot suffix. Signed-off-by: Amjad Afzaal <bcsf09m001@pucit.edu.pk>
2012-09-25imx35pdk: Add machine definitionMuhammad Usman1-0/+32
Change-Id: Icd0514481da4bfd392b0cca36fbc13d0318dca73 Signed-off-by: Muhammad Usman <m.usmannn@gmail.com>
2012-09-24imx6qsabresd: Add machine definitionOtavio Salvador1-0/+28
Change-Id: I548d97f785ab05099d290b10121963feb2952c8b Signed-off-by: Otavio Salvador <otavio@ossystems.com.br> Acked-by: Daiane Angolini <daiane.angolini@freescale.com>
2012-09-24imx31pdk: Add machine definitionAmjad Afzaal1-0/+29
Signed-off-by: Amjad Afzaal <bcsf09m001@pucit.edu.pk>
2012-09-19imx-base.inc: use new firmware-imx packageOtavio Salvador1-1/+1
The use of imx-firmware, while supported, is not recommended so we now use the new package name. Change-Id: I434e5c41f7856839ddee6f7ca74a21da9fd260e0 Signed-off-by: Otavio Salvador <otavio@ossystems.com.br>
2012-09-18Merge remote branch 'freescale/denzil'Otavio Salvador5-6/+18
* freescale/denzil: Move fsl-default*.inc from distro to machine
2012-09-18Move fsl-default*.inc from distro to machineAndrei Gherzan5-6/+18
It makes no sense to have distro related configurations in a BSP layer. So let's have these common parts (provides, version etc) in machine directory instead. Signed-off-by: Andrei Gherzan <andrei.gherzan@windriver.com>
2012-09-17Merge remote branch 'freescale/denzil'Otavio Salvador2-4/+4
* freescale/denzil: imx6qsabrelite: Use xserver-xorg instead of xserver-xorg-lite cogl: Use OpenGL ES2 for mx5 SoCs imx-base.inc: Set preferred implementation of virtual/libgl for mx5 SoCs amd-gpu-x11-bin-mx51: Add provides to 'virtual/libgl'
2012-09-17imx6qsabrelite: Use xserver-xorg instead of xserver-xorg-liteOtavio Salvador1-4/+2
Next Yocto release will drop xserver-xorg-lite as building xserver-xorg and not installing the DRI and GLX modules (and so not Mesa) results in an increase of 16kb only. Signed-off-by: Otavio Salvador <otavio@ossystems.com.br>
2012-09-17imx-base.inc: Set preferred implementation of virtual/libgl for mx5 SoCsOtavio Salvador1-0/+2
The mx5 SoCs need to use amd-gpu-x11-bin-mx51 to proper support acceleration however it wasn't being taken in place in machine configuration. This adds the need settings and fix the issue for all mx5 based machines. Signed-off-by: Otavio Salvador <otavio@ossystems.com.br>
2012-09-17Merge remote branch 'freescale/denzil'Otavio Salvador1-0/+3
* freescale/denzil: imx6qsabrelite: force MACHINE_GSTREAMER_PLUGIN until codecs are available
2012-09-17imx6qsabrelite: force MACHINE_GSTREAMER_PLUGIN until codecs are availableEric Bénard1-0/+3
else we get : ERROR: fsl-mm-codeclib was skipped: incompatible with machine imx6qsabrelite (not in COMPATIBLE_MACHINE) NOTE: Runtime target 'gst-fsl-plugin' is unbuildable, removing... Missing or unbuildable dependency chain was: ['gst-fsl-plugin', 'fsl-mm-codeclib'] NOTE: Runtime target 'task-fsl-gstreamer' is unbuildable, removing... Missing or unbuildable dependency chain was: ['task-fsl-gstreamer', 'gst-fsl-plugin', 'fsl-mm-codeclib'] ERROR: Required build target 'fsl-image-test' has no buildable providers. Missing or unbuildable dependency chain was: ['fsl-image-test', 'task-fsl-gstreamer', 'gst-fsl-plugin', 'fsl-mm-codeclib'] Signed-off-by: Eric Bénard <eric@eukrea.com>
2012-09-13mxs-base.inc: Disable perf tool features as Linux 2.6.35.3 failsOtavio Salvador1-0/+3
The perf tool build fails in upcoming Yocto 1.3 as it try to enable perf-scripting but perl and python linking is not working in current default kernel. Signed-off-by: Otavio Salvador <otavio@ossystems.com.br>
2012-09-13imx-base.inc: Disable perf tool features as Linux 2.6.35.3 failsOtavio Salvador1-0/+3
The perf tool build fails in upcoming Yocto 1.3 as it try to enable perf-scripting but perl and python linking is not working in current default kernel. Signed-off-by: Otavio Salvador <otavio@ossystems.com.br>
2012-09-13Merge remote branch 'freescale/denzil' into masterOtavio Salvador2-6/+4
* freescale/denzil: mxs-base.inc: Use xserver-xorg instead of xserver-xorg-lite imx-base.inc: Use xserver-xorg instead of xserver-xorg-lite fsl-default-providers.inc: Change virtual/xserver to xserver-xorg imx-base.inc: Remove useless SoC override for U-Boot settings u-boot: Fix mx28evk bootargs
2012-09-13mxs-base.inc: Use xserver-xorg instead of xserver-xorg-liteOtavio Salvador1-1/+1
Next Yocto release will drop xserver-xorg-lite as building xserver-xorg and not installing the DRI and GLX modules (and so not Mesa) results in an increase of 16kb only. Signed-off-by: Otavio Salvador <otavio@ossystems.com.br> Acked-by: Rogerio Pimentel <rogerio.pimentel@freescale.com>
2012-09-13imx-base.inc: Use xserver-xorg instead of xserver-xorg-liteOtavio Salvador1-1/+1
Next Yocto release will drop xserver-xorg-lite as building xserver-xorg and not installing the DRI and GLX modules (and so not Mesa) results in an increase of 16kb only. Signed-off-by: Otavio Salvador <otavio@ossystems.com.br> Acked-by: Rogerio Pimentel <rogerio.pimentel@freescale.com>
2012-09-13imx-base.inc: Remove useless SoC override for U-Boot settingsOtavio Salvador1-4/+2
The U-Boot settings are the same for mx5 and mx6 SoCs so we don't need a override for it. Signed-off-by: Otavio Salvador <otavio@ossystems.com.br> Acked-by: Rogerio Pimentel <rogerio.pimentel@freescale.com>
2012-08-02imx6qsabrelite: use udev-extraconfOtavio Salvador1-1/+1
The udev-extra-rules has been replaced by udev-extraconf so this needs to be changed on machine definitions. Signed-off-by: Otavio Salvador <otavio@ossystems.com.br> Acked-by: Rogerio Pimentel <rogerio.pimentel@freescale.com>
2012-08-02imx-base.inc: use udev-extraconfOtavio Salvador1-1/+1
The udev-extra-rules has been replaced by udev-extraconf so this needs to be changed on machine definitions. Signed-off-by: Otavio Salvador <otavio@ossystems.com.br> Acked-by: Rogerio Pimentel <rogerio.pimentel@freescale.com>
2012-07-25Merge remote-tracking branch 'freescale/denzil' into masterOtavio Salvador1-2/+4
* freescale/denzil: imx6qsabrelite: do not recommends BSP package are they are not public yet alsa-state: custom asound.conf file for iMX targets
2012-07-25imx6qsabrelite: do not recommends BSP package are they are not public yetOtavio Salvador1-2/+4
Signed-off-by: Otavio Salvador <otavio@ossystems.com.br> Acked-by: Daiane Angolini <daiane.angolini@freescale.com>
2012-07-10imx6qsabrelite: add device tree kernel targetOtavio Salvador1-0/+2
Signed-off-by: Otavio Salvador <otavio@ossystems.com.br>
2012-07-10imx53qsb: add device tree kernel targetOtavio Salvador1-0/+2
Signed-off-by: Otavio Salvador <otavio@ossystems.com.br>
2012-07-10imx53ard: add device tree kernel targetOtavio Salvador1-0/+2
Signed-off-by: Otavio Salvador <otavio@ossystems.com.br>
2012-07-10imx51evk: add device tree kernel targetOtavio Salvador1-0/+2
Signed-off-by: Otavio Salvador <otavio@ossystems.com.br>
2012-07-10imx28evk: add device tree kernel targetOtavio Salvador1-0/+1
Signed-off-by: Otavio Salvador <otavio@ossystems.com.br>
2012-07-10imx23evk: add device tree kernel targetOtavio Salvador1-0/+1
Signed-off-by: Otavio Salvador <otavio@ossystems.com.br>
2012-07-04imx-base: set common machine featuresAdrian Alonso4-1/+7
* Set common machine features * imx53qsb, imx53ard add wifi and bluetooth support * imx6qsabrelite add pci to machine features Signed-off-by: Adrian Alonso <aalonso00@gmail.com>
2012-07-04imx-base: add wifi and bluetooth machine featuresAdrian Alonso1-1/+1
* Add wifi and bluetooh machine features. Signed-off-by: Adrian Alonso <aalonso00@gmail.com>
2012-07-03fsl-default-revisions.inc: remove as we ought to have it per recipeAdrian Alonso2-2/+0
The revision ought to be set for every recipe as we support different versions per machine. Signed-off-by: Otavio Salvador <otavio@ossystems.com.br> Acked-by: Adrian Alonso <aalonso00@gmail.com>
2012-07-02imx-base.inc: Add udev-extra-rules packageDaiane Angolini1-1/+3
Add udev extra rules from 10-imx.rules file in MACHINE_EXTRA_RRECOMENDS Signed-off-by: Daiane Angolini <daiane.angolini@freescale.com>
2012-06-17mxs-base.inc: cleanup recommended packages removing multimedia onesOtavio Salvador1-6/+0
The multimedia packages need to be moved to a specific task to allow images to use, or not it, and avoid enforcing it onto every image. Signed-off-by: Otavio Salvador <otavio@ossystems.com.br>
2012-06-05imx-base.inc: add MACHINE_GSTREAMER_PLUGINOtavio Salvador1-0/+3
This allow for optmized support for gstramer for audio/video codecs. Signed-off-by: Otavio Salvador <otavio@ossystems.com.br> Acked-by: Adrian Alonso <aalonso@freescale.com>
2012-05-29imx-base.inc: cleanup recommended packages removing multimedia onesOtavio Salvador1-5/+4
The multimedia packages need to be moved to a specific task to allow images to use, or not it, and avoid enforcing it onto every image. Signed-off-by: Otavio Salvador <otavio@ossystems.com.br>
2012-05-28imx6qsabrelite: fix machine descriptionOtavio Salvador1-2/+2
Signed-off-by: Otavio Salvador <otavio@ossystems.com.br>
2012-05-28imx53qsb: fix machine descriptionOtavio Salvador1-2/+2
Signed-off-by: Otavio Salvador <otavio@ossystems.com.br>
2012-05-28imx53ard: fix machine descriptionOtavio Salvador1-2/+2
Signed-off-by: Otavio Salvador <otavio@ossystems.com.br>
2012-05-28imx51evk: fix machine descriptionOtavio Salvador1-2/+2
Signed-off-by: Otavio Salvador <otavio@ossystems.com.br>
2012-05-28imx28evk.conf: fix machine descriptionOtavio Salvador1-2/+2
Signed-off-by: Otavio Salvador <otavio@ossystems.com.br>
2012-05-21imx53qsb: move to mainline's based version of u-bootOtavio Salvador1-7/+0
Signed-off-by: Otavio Salvador <otavio@ossystems.com.br>
2012-05-21imx23evk: add machine definitionOtavio Salvador1-0/+16
Signed-off-by: Otavio Salvador <otavio@ossystems.com.br>
2012-05-21imx28evk: add IMXBOOTLETS_MACHINE settingOtavio Salvador1-0/+2
Add support to generate imx-bootlets code for i.MX28 target. Signed-off-by: Otavio Salvador <otavio@ossystems.com.br>
2012-05-21imx28evk: move generic code to mxs-base.incOtavio Salvador2-18/+28
To avoid metadata duplication we provide a mxs-base.inc to be used for every i.MXS based board. Signed-off-by: Otavio Salvador <otavio@ossystems.com.br>
2012-05-21imx28evk: use ttyAMA as debug serialOtavio Salvador1-1/+1
Signed-off-by: Otavio Salvador <otavio@ossystems.com.br>
2012-05-21imx28evk: remove deprecated XSERVER packagesOtavio Salvador1-3/+0
Nowadays the evdev driver, from Xorg, can handle keyboard, mice and touchscreen so we don't need to install the old drivers anymore. Signed-off-by: Otavio Salvador <otavio@ossystems.com.br>
2012-05-02imx6qsabrelite: add XSERVER definition using fbdev driverOtavio Salvador1-0/+6
Signed-off-by: Otavio Salvador <otavio@ossystems.com.br>
2012-05-01imx28evk: add default image fstypesOtavio Salvador1-1/+1
Signed-off-by: Otavio Salvador <otavio@ossystems.com.br>
2012-04-30imx28evk: add machine definitionOtavio Salvador1-0/+41
Signed-off-by: Otavio Salvador <otavio@ossystems.com.br>